区块链网络的共识机制对安全性的影响是什么?
区块链网络的共识机制在"https://www.chainsafeai.com/" title="区块链安全">区块链安全性中扮演着至关重要的角色。所有参与节点必须达成一致,以确保网络的合法性和有效性。不同的共识机制对安全性产生不同的影响,了解这一点有助于评估区块链系统的鲁棒性和抗攻击能力。
共识机制的核心任务是验证交易和区块的真实性。安全性高的共识机制能够阻止恶意行为者操纵网络。例如,工作量证明通过要求节点解决复杂的数学问题,增加了攻击的成本,这在一定程度上提高了系统的安全性。攻击者需要耗费大量计算资源,才能形成一家独大的局面。这种机制通过引入难度,使得恶意操作的成本不可承受,从而保护了网络的完整性。
除了工作量证明,权益证明也是一种常见的共识方式。它通过要求节点锁定一定数量的资产参与共识,降低了节点的流动性。这样做有助于提高网络的安全性,因为节点的财富与网络的价值息息相关。如果节点试图攻击网络,他们将面临失去锁定资产的风险。权益证明系统在激励机制上设计得更加精细,从而促使参与者保持诚实的行为。
在区块链网络中,网络节点的数量和分布也会影响共识机制的安全性。高数量和广泛分布的节点有助于形成更多的冗余,从而降低单点故障的风险。而相对稀疏的节点分布可能导致某一特定区域或特定节点承担过多的责任,增加了被攻击的几率。在这种情况下,攻击者可能通过吸引网络中部分节点参与,形成双重支出的风险,影响整个网络的稳定性和安全性。
共识机制并不是孤立存在的,它与网络的治理结构密切相关。去中心化的治理结构可以使得系统更加安全,因为所有节点都有权利参与决策。去中心化的特性使得恶意行为者难以掌控绝大多数节点,从而无法发动大规模攻击。通过透明的治理流程,社区成员能够及时发现并修复潜在的安全漏洞。
共识机制的选择也涉及到处理速度和效率的问题。虽然安全性是首要考虑的因素,但处理能力的不足可能导致交易确认时间延长,进而影响用户体验。在一些情况下,较低的处理速度可能反过来影响安全性,因为网络在于熟悉的验证活动中拖延会导致节点间的不信任。寻找安全与效率之间的平衡是设计共识机制时必须面对的重要挑战。
经济模型也是共识机制的重要组成部分。设计一个合理的奖励和惩罚机制可以吸引诚实的节点参与,而不诚实的行为会受到惩罚。这种机制不仅有助于保护网络安全,也能促进参与者的长期投入。例如,若节点在参与共识时失败,可能会失去一定的权益,从而增加了不当行为的成本。
许多新兴的共识机制也在不断涌现,包括委任权益证明、份额证明和BFT(拜占庭容错)。这些机制在提高安全性的同时,也在寻求降低能耗和资源消耗,让网络更加高效。而这类新兴机制是否能够在实践中成功落地,也取决于它们如何处理安全性和效率之间的关系。
共识机制的设计和实施需要考虑多样的威胁模型和攻击场景。攻击者的动机多种多样,如从经济利益到系统的控制权等。因此,评估共识机制的安全性不仅要基于技术层面,也应考虑到经济、社会和法律因素的综合影响。这种多维度的动态分析可以帮助设计出更加安全的共识机制,以应对潜在的威胁。
区块链技术仍在不断演进,随着技术和市场的变化,新的共识机制将不断被提出和实验。无论是通过加密学的手段还是通过经济激励来维护网络安全,所有这些因素都将在未来的区块链环境中持续发挥作用。通过不断优化和改进共识机制,能够在保证安全性的前提下,实现更高效和可靠的区块链网络。
ChainSafeAI(链熵科技)专注于区块链生态安全,以“数据驱动 + 技术赋能”构建360°全方位安全防护体系,服务于交易所、金融机构、OTC服务商及加密资产投资者。公司提供覆盖KYT风险监测、智能"https://www.chainsafeai.com/" title="合约审计">合约审计、加密资产追踪、区块链漏洞测试等在内的全维度安全与合规技术解决方案,助力客户防范洗钱、诈骗等风险,保障业务合规运行。通过实时风险预警、合规审查与资金溯源分析,协助客户识别链上异常行为、防范洗钱及诈骗风险、降低被盗损失并提升资产追回可能性。